Essential Upgrades: The Building Blocks of Better Printing

Okay, let’s get down to brass tacks. These are the upgrades that will give you the most bang for your buck. Think of them as the “must-have” modifications for any serious Ender 3 enthusiast.

Bed Springs: Stability Starts from the Ground Up

Seriously, bed springs? Yes! Those stock springs are… not great. They compress easily, leading to bed leveling issues that can drive you absolutely bonkers. Upgraded springs, usually made of stiffer metal, will hold your bed firmly in place, making leveling easier and ensuring your first layer sticks consistently. Metal Extruder: Ditch the Plastic, Embrace the Strength

That stock plastic extruder? It’s another weak point. Plastic can crack or wear down over time, leading to inconsistent filament feeding. A metal extruder is far more durable and provides a more consistent grip on the filament, resulting in more reliable prints. It is a small investment that pays huge dividends in terms of reliability and print quality.

Capricorn PTFE Tubing: Precision Filament Delivery

The PTFE tube guides the filament from the extruder to the hot end. Capricorn tubing is made from a higher quality PTFE that has a tighter inner diameter and lower friction. This leads to more accurate filament delivery and reduces the chances of clogs, especially when printing with flexible filaments. BLTouch Auto Bed Leveling: Say Goodbye to Leveling Woes

This is where things get fancy. Auto bed leveling probes, like the BLTouch, automatically measure the distance between the nozzle and the bed at multiple points, compensating for any imperfections. This eliminates the need for manual bed leveling, which, let’s be honest, can be a total pain. It’s a game-changer, especially for larger prints. Some people swear by this; some hate it. Nice-to-Have Upgrades: Taking Your Prints to the Next Level

Once you’ve tackled the essentials, these upgrades can further enhance your printing experience. They’re not strictly necessary, but they can definitely make your life easier and your prints even better.

All-Metal Hotend: Unleash High-Temperature Printing

The stock hotend has a PTFE liner inside that can degrade at higher temperatures, limiting the materials you can print with. An all-metal hotend eliminates the PTFE liner, allowing you to print with materials like nylon and polycarbonate, which require higher temperatures. If you’re interested in experimenting with different materials, this is a must-have.

Direct Drive Extruder: Taming Flexible Filaments

In a Bowden setup (like the stock Ender 3), the extruder is mounted on the frame, and the filament travels through a long tube to the hotend. This can be problematic with flexible filaments, as they tend to buckle and bend inside the tube. A direct drive extruder mounts the extruder directly on top of the hotend, reducing the distance the filament has to travel and making it easier to print with flexible materials like TPU.

Silent Motherboard: Silence is Golden

The stock stepper drivers on the Ender 3 can be quite noisy. A silent motherboard uses different stepper drivers that significantly reduce the noise level of the printer. If you’re tired of the constant whirring and buzzing, this is the upgrade for you. You won’t believe the difference it makes!

Raspberry Pi with OctoPrint: Remote Control and Monitoring

Okay, this isn’t technically an upgrade *to* the Ender 3, but it’s an upgrade *to your entire 3D printing workflow*. A Raspberry Pi running OctoPrint allows you to control and monitor your printer remotely via a web interface. You can start and stop prints, adjust settings, and even monitor progress with a webcam, all from your computer or smartphone. It’s incredibly convenient.

Troubleshooting: When Things Go Wrong (And They Will)

Let’s be real: things don’t always go according to plan. Upgrading your Ender 3 can be a learning experience, and you’re bound to run into some snags along the way. Here’s how to handle common problems.

My Prints Aren’t Sticking to the Bed!

Ah, the dreaded first layer adhesion problem. This is a classic. Make sure your bed is properly leveled, clean, and heated to the correct temperature. You can also try using a brim or raft to increase the surface area of the first layer. Hair spray or glue stick can also help add grip.

My Extruder Keeps Clicking!

Clicking usually indicates that the extruder is having trouble pushing the filament through the hotend. This could be due to a clog, a damaged nozzle, or the hotend temperature being too low. Try cleaning the nozzle, increasing the hotend temperature, or checking for obstructions in the filament path.

My Prints Are Coming Out Warped!

Warping is often caused by uneven cooling, which causes the plastic to contract and lift off the bed. Make sure your printer is in a draft-free environment, and try increasing the bed temperature. Enclosures can also help maintain a more consistent temperature.

My BLTouch Isn’t Working!

BLTouch can definitely come with its own set of challenges. Double-check that all the wires are connected correctly and that the firmware is properly configured. If you’re still having trouble, consult the BLTouch documentation or ask for help on a forum.

FAQ: Your Burning Questions Answered

What are the first upgrades I should do?

Start with the essentials: upgraded bed springs, a metal extruder, and Capricorn PTFE tubing. These provide immediate improvements in print quality and reliability.

How much will it cost to upgrade my Ender 3?

That depends on how far you take it. Essential upgrades can cost as little as $30-$50, while more advanced upgrades like a BLTouch or all-metal hotend can add another $50-$100 each.

Will upgrading void my warranty?

Modifying your printer may void the warranty. Check the terms of your warranty before making any changes. However, many manufacturers are understanding and will still provide support for non-modified parts.
